Located in the heart of Clinton, Illinois, Woodward Park offers a welcoming, family-friendly atmosphere with plenty of open space for both kids and pets to enjoy. Known for its spacious grounds and clean environment, this park is an excellent choice for those looking to spend quality time outdoors with their furry friends. While not exclusively a dog park, it is a pet-friendly location popular with local residents.
Woodward Park features updated playground equipment, ample room to run and play, and a pavilion that makes it convenient for picnics and gatherings. Though primarily designed for children, responsible dog owners frequently bring their pets to the park to walk and socialize in a relaxed setting. It’s a great spot to enjoy the fresh air, whether you’re looking for dog-friendly hiking or simply a scenic spot for a stroll with your canine companion.
